Here is a guide on how you can leverage KanBo and Collaboration to manage your workweek as a Product Owner for central E/E components in the Automotive Industry.
Monday: Start your week by creating a new Workspace for your project. Invite your team members to join, and create spaces for each functional area. You can use Spaces to organize your tasks, centralize your documents, and communicate with the team.
Tuesday: Use KanBo Cards to create tasks for your team. Assign team members, set deadlines, and add relevant documents. If you need to discuss a specific task, use the Comments section to communicate with your team members.
Wednesday: Schedule a Card to plan your workweek. Use the Scheduling feature to set the start and end date for a task. The card will automatically appear on your Schedule calendar, helping you visualize your workload for the upcoming week.
Thursday: Use the Gantt Chart and Timeline view to track progress and ensure that your project stays on track. These visualizations can help you identify critical tasks and delays and take corrective actions.
Friday: Take time to review progress and prepare dashboards and reports for your stakeholders. Use the data visualization features to create custom views and measure project health. Share these dashboards with stakeholders and keep them updated on your progress.

Furthermore, KanBo offers a range of views to help you visualize your work and gain insights. You can choose from Kanban view, list view, table view (spreadsheet), calendar view, Gantt chart, timeline view, activity view, document view, mind map view, and more. These views allow you to see your work from different perspectives, which help you make informed decisions and stay on top of your tasks.
